  4. 9. Assembly and Secretion of Atherogenic Lipoproteins

    Author : Caroline Beck; Göteborgs universitet; []
    Keywords : very low-density lipoprotein; ; apolipoprotein B100; ; B-cell receptor associated; microsomal triglyceride transfer protein; ; secretion; assembly;

    Abstract : The classical dyslipidemia seen in patients with type 2 diabetes is characterized by elevated serum triglycerides (TG), low levels of high-density lipoprotein cholesterol and the appearance of small, dense low-density lipoproteins (LDL). It is now recognized that the different components of diabetic dyslipidemia are not isolated abnormalities but are closely linked to each other metabolically, and are initiated by the hepatic overproduction of large triglyceride-rich very low-density lipoproteins (VLDL1).
